Penelope is the former apprentice to the late Neptune. When she was younger, She was a quite eccentric Coatl and a promising Medic, memorising every technique Vermiculus had discovered and taught. She enjoyed using new methods of healing as well, diving deep down to access such medicines. Vermiculus appreciates the new supply, some of the new medicine even served as a back up during the harsh winters when some of the herbs don't grow or are too scarce in the first place. She was oftentimes found by the beach behind the training grounds, as the clan is located in a ancient cliff near the border of the Icefields in the Starwood Strand. If she isn't at the Beach, shes in the den with her Mentor or sunbasking.

In recent times, Penelope developed farming methods for her clan, and for the healers, this meant year-round herbs of all kinds. After her late mentor's death, she became a more serious healer.
Some blame her for the Midsummer Plague of the first year just because she mistook it for another strain. When Penelope is forced to relax for her sake, she heads to the top of their new lair to bask in the sun, before ultimately crashing into a well-earned sleep.
